What are the state licensure requirements for barbers in Iowa?

Completion of a high school diploma and apprenticeship

Completion of a barbering program and passing the state board exam

The correct answer outlines the necessary steps for becoming a licensed barber in Iowa, emphasizing the importance of both education and examination. Completing a barbering program is crucial, as it provides the foundational skills, techniques, and knowledge required to perform barbering services safely and effectively. This program must be accredited and meet state-specific curriculum standards.

Passing the state board exam is equally important as it assesses the applicant’s knowledge of barbering practices, safety procedures, and state regulations. This exam ensures that individuals meet the professional standards required for public safety and service quality in the barbering industry.

By fulfilling these requirements, individuals demonstrate their preparedness to work as licensed barbers in Iowa, maintaining a professional standard that protects both the clients and the integrity of the profession. Other options do not accurately reflect Iowa’s licensure criteria; for example, an apprenticeship may be part of the learning process, but it is not a standalone licensing requirement. Similarly, online training or completing a cosmetology program does not substitute for the specific barbering education and examination mandated by the state.
